Partridge Lake

Aerial view of Partridge Lake, a 235 acre lake in Boulder Junction, Wisconsin

Partridge Lake sits in a wooded pocket near Boulder Junction with a mix of public land and light private development along its shoreline.

Its modest size and low traffic make it a straightforward, backwoods-style cabin lake for buyers who prioritize seclusion over name recognition.

Partridge Lake Specs:

Avg. Depth: 9 Feet
Size: 235 Acres
Max Depth: 19 Feet
Water Source:
Lake Access: Public
Time to Town: 7 Minutes

How big is Partridge Lake?

Partridge Lake is 235 acres.

How deep is Partridge Lake?

Partridge Lake has an average depth of 9 feet and a maximum depth of 19 feet.

How far is Partridge Lake from Boulder Junction?

Partridge Lake is 7 minutes from Boulder Junction, Wisconsin.

What type of lake is Partridge Lake?

Partridge Lake is a Spring lake.
